                @marc-van-der-heijden said in New update! (4.2.0) In-app MRA Routeplanner:

                in de iPhone is het volgens mij gewoon app sluiten,

                Op de iPhone moet je vanaf de onderkant van het scherm omhoog vegen. Daarna swipe je naar links of rechts om de app te zoeken die je wilt stoppen. Als je de app dan in beeld hebt in de voorvertoning, dan veeg je die app naar boven om hem gedwongen te stoppen.

                ik sluit sowieso vaak apps

                Ik laat ze altijd actief. Op een iPhone is het onnodig om je apps af te sluiten. Vaak wordt gedacht dat het de batterijduur verlengt als je een app volledig afsluit. De meningen zijn daarover verdeeld maar Apple zelf zegt dat het alleen nodig is als een app niet meer reageert.

                  Good morning MyRoute-app users!
                  We are proud to announce the upcoming release of the in-app MRA Routeplanner 🎉

                  After elaborate testing by the Alpha and Beta testers, we are confident that this will be an epic release 💥 With pride we present the in-app MRA Routeplanner to you!

                  render_main_small.png

                  With this routeplanner you can edit your high quality MRA routes with an interface it deserves.

                  • Edit any existing route! 💪
                  • Create a new route from scratch
                  • Change routes from others
                  • All this can even be done offline! 🎉

                  render_open.png

                  The Routeplanner offers many features to help you in building lovely routes.

                  render_build.png

                  Quickly keep adding waypoints to your route to shape the route to your preference.

                  • Yellow button starts the adding process and keep tapping it to continuously add waypoints
                  • Click add to add a new waypoint and stop adding more
                  • Cancel, dismiss what you are doing

                  If you make a mistake, no problem! Simply use the undo / redo buttons like you are used to in the website 😉

                  Do you want to add information to waypoints? Ofcourse you can do so! 🎉

                  render_info_2.png

                  Change the colour, type, note, title, pause duration or even the icon of the waypoint! 😮

                  Do you want to add a waypoint somewhere along the route? Obviously that's possible too!

                  • Tap somewhere along the line to add a waypoint there in order of the route
                  • Long press and drag a line to immediately move the marker you are adding in that leg

                  render_add.png

                  Do you need to move a waypoint precisely? Simply use the advanced move interface to place the waypoint exactly where you want. Long pressing and dragging the waypoint works too but that is less precise 🙂

                  render_move_search.png

                  Then we also allow you to change any of the other settings.

                  render_settings.png

                  • Edit the name / description of the route.
                  • Alter the privacy / travel mode
                  • Avoid specific type of roads
                  • View all the waypoints

                  Talking about waypoints! Did you know you can drag the waypoints shown in the list to reorder them? 😏 When you've opened a waypoint you can also swipe left / right to jump to the previous / next waypoint 😮

                  That's it really!
                  So in short:

                  • Create new routes from scratch
                  • Edit any route
                  • Access to our unique MRA Routeplanner features in-app
                  • Modify waypoints
                  • Change route information / details / options

                  Feel free to discover all other features yourself 😉

                  Isn't this an amazing update??? We have put a lot of focus in the visual appearance and user experience of this planner so we hope you are satisfied.

                  In the upcoming update we will rework your route library to enable easy syncing of all your routes. Meaning that offline created routes will be synced to the website when online again, you can automatically sync routes / your entire library between website and app! 🎉 But that's for later 😉

                                @Brian-McG said in New update! (4.2.0) In-app MRA Routeplanner:

                                I hope that along with map layers they are able to include the comparison of routes between the different routing algorithms, Here, TomTom & OPenStreetMap

                                I am afraid I can disappoint you by proxy of the devs for this feature...
                                Reason for this is that, unlike the web-planner, the app-planner is build within the HERE SDK, and they don't offer facilities to compare with other map providers as you will probably understand 😉 . The web-planner, in contrast to this, does not use the HERE SDK, but an API to the routing service. Clever devs combined multiple such API's from different map providers into one webbased program of their own.

                                In short, the basis on which the app-planner is build does not allow combination of multiple map providers.
